Omnia at Caesars Palace

Caesars Palace

The most technically advanced nightclub in the world

A three-level, 75,000 sq ft spectacle of sound and light. The main room's kinetic chandelier — 22 feet wide, 16 feet tall, with 7,000 LED nodes — is the most iconic piece of nightclub engineering ever built. The rooftop terrace overlooks the Strip. Hakkasan

MGM Grand·$$$

Six floors. Michelin-starred dining. Then the club opens.

The world's most awarded nightclub brand brought its flagship to MGM Grand. Six levels of entertainment — dine on Michelin-starred Cantonese, then descend into one of the world's great superclubs as the DJ takes over.

The Chandelier at The Cosmopolitan

The Cosmopolitan·$$

Three bars inside a two-million crystal chandelier

The Cosmopolitan's centrepiece is a three-story bar suspended inside a curtain of two million crystals. Each level has its own vibe — from the buzzy ground floor to the intimate top-level lounge. Order the Verbena: it comes with a Szechuan button that makes your mouth tingle.

Brooklyn Bowl

The LINQ·$$

Bowling, BBQ, and live music — all under one roof

The Las Vegas outpost of the beloved Brooklyn original brings 32 lanes of bowling, a full BBQ menu, and a 2,000-capacity live music venue to The LINQ. The lineup spans indie, hip-hop, country, and everything in between.

The Laundry Room

Downtown Las Vegas·$$$

No sign. No menu. Reservations by text only.

Hidden behind a laundromat in Downtown Las Vegas, The Laundry Room is the city's most secretive cocktail bar. Text for a reservation, find the hidden entrance, and let the bartenders craft something bespoke. Maximum 20 guests at a time.

How Vegas Nightlife Works

The Unwritten Rules

1

Nothing starts before midnight

Clubs don't hit their stride until 1–2 AM. Arriving at 10 PM means an empty room and a long wait. Eat late, pre-game at a bar, and arrive after midnight.

2

Guest list is everything

Every major club has a guest list — get on it. It's usually free for women and discounted for men. Check the club's website or Instagram the week of your visit.

3

Table service is a different world

Bottle service unlocks the best spots in the room, dedicated servers, and a base to operate from all night. Minimums start around $500 — split between a group it's often worth it.

4

Dress code is enforced

Upscale casual at minimum. No athletic wear, no flip-flops, no sports jerseys. Women generally have more flexibility. When in doubt, overdress.

Insider Knowledge

Nightlife Tips

1

Pre-book tickets for major clubs online — door prices are always higher and popular nights sell out.

2

Uber and Lyft surge pricing peaks at 2–3 AM. Either leave before 2 AM or wait until 4 AM when it settles.

3

The Fremont Street Experience is free, open-air, and a completely different energy to the Strip — worth one night.
